A victory to the home team is anticipated from this match if the league standings is to be believed. The Richmond Kickers followers are optimistic that the contrast between 1st and Northern Colorado's 10th position in the table will be revealed on the playing field.

Richmond Kickers form and stats

3-3-1 (win-draw-lost) are the USL League One numbers at home for Richmond Kickers so far this season.

Richmond Kickers's previous game was also played at home, ending 4-0 versus Charlotte Independence (placed 5th). The home side are looking to build on that result. As mentioned above, Richmond Kickers "killed" Charlotte Independence in their previous game. They need to reset completely for this one and beware of complacency.

The spoils were shared after 90 minutes before that, a home game that ended 2-2 versus Tormenta.

With an average of more than two goals per home game in the league (15 in 7 games), Richmond's attacking play is working. Richmond Kickers are not conceding a lot of goals here at City Stadium in the league, averaging less than one per game. The total is 5 from 7 matches.

Northern Colorado form and stats

2 wins, 2 draws and 2 losses. That’s the product of Northern Colorado playing as the away team in the USL League One this season. The last three matches for Northern Colorado have all ended in a draw.

Northern Colorado's last game ended in a draw, the home match versus Tormenta that finished 1-1. As mentioned above, Northern drew the match against Tormenta. Manager Zayed brought on Nortey to rescue the draw from a losing position and it worked.

Ahead of that game was the 1-1 draw at home against North Carolina.

The visitors are returning home after this fixture, hosting Central Valley Fuego in just four days.

Northern Colorado find the net regularly in their away games. 7 goals from 6 away fixtures in the league. In the opposite end, Northern Colorado have conceded 9 goals in their away games. Northern has visited these top teams two times, and 2 of 2 has ended with 2 goals or more!

USL League One is the third level of football in the United States and Canada. It is brand new; launched in 2019. The league currently holds ten teams but this is likely to expand. Regular season has 28 games played from March to October, followed by a playoff.
